Transaction 6134502027c8e4c584df9cb2fd64c5ab865e82884c83010c68e02eeb8a356d7a
1 Input
1 Output
-
6134502027c8e4c584df9cb2fd64c5ab865e82884c83010c68e02eeb8a356d7a:0
- value
- 529634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8550955dc3e5a713f2761c5f8d405ffc5c16a5c OP_EQUAL
- address
- 3H35KD3kLe38uexKSWmbjA8LxBjtSvqaHk